Club Deportivo Audax Italiano La Florida, commonly known as Audax Italiano, is a professional football club based in La Florida, Santiago, Chile. The club was founded on November 30, 1910, by Italian immigrants who wanted to establish a sports club that would reflect their Italian heritage. The club's name, "Audax", is Latin for "bold", reflecting the founders' adventurous spirit.
Audax Italiano has a rich history in Chilean football, having participated in the country's top-tier league, the Campeonato Nacional, for many decades. The club has won the league title four times, with their most recent championship coming in the 1957 season. They have also been runners-up on several occasions.
The club's home matches are played at the Estadio Bicentenario de La Florida, a modern stadium with a capacity of 12,000 spectators. The stadium is known for its vibrant atmosphere, with the club's passionate supporters, known as the "audinos", providing a colourful backdrop to matches.
Over the years, Audax Italiano has developed a reputation for nurturing young talent. The club's youth academy has produced several players who have gone on to represent the Chilean national team, including Carlos Labrín, Bryan Carrasco, and Sebastián Vegas. The club's commitment to youth development is reflected in its motto, "La Fábrica de Sueños", which translates as "The Dream Factory".
Audax Italiano's traditional colours are green and white, which feature prominently in the club's crest and kit. The crest is a shield divided into two halves, with the left side featuring a green and white striped pattern, and the right side featuring the club's initials, "AI", in green on a white background. The club's kit typically consists of a green and white striped shirt, white shorts, and green socks.
The club has a long-standing rivalry with Unión Española, another Santiago-based club with immigrant roots. Matches between the two teams, known as the "Clásico de Colonias", are highly anticipated events in the Chilean football calendar.
In recent years, Audax Italiano has also competed in international competitions, such as the Copa Sudamericana and the Copa Libertadores, further enhancing its reputation as one of Chile's leading football clubs.
